Output e51f32fdb2926118fa28bb089cc2a3424b1dc0268ebc640ac6627d86cbfd8fec:158
- value
- 32843
- script pubkey
- OP_0 OP_PUSHBYTES_20 50a19e70d4da020fc0966324860177ffa144d6a8
- address
- bc1q2zseuux5mgpqlsykvvjgvqthl7s5f44g6arjn7
- transaction
- e51f32fdb2926118fa28bb089cc2a3424b1dc0268ebc640ac6627d86cbfd8fec